9. 1978 Plymouth Arrow Race Car for $69,900 - SOLD

Details from seller: 

Featured in the September 2014 issue of Mopar Collector's guide
Previously a Pro Stock car
Custom Ronnie Sox-inspired vehicle wrap
Aluminum 498 CI Keith Black retro Pro Stock Hemi V-8 engine
Stage V heads
Magnesium Weiand tunnel ram
Crank-triggered ignition
15.1:1 compression
Fab 9 rear end
296R camshaft
Quickfuel 1050 CFM Dominator carburetors
Lenco transmission
McLeod clutch and Lakewood bellhousing
Chris Alston chromoly tube chassis
7.5 funny car cage
Polished Centerline wheels
Currently certified for NHRA 7.50
Street legal
Dashboard signed by Big Daddy Don Garlits

An 87 Acre Motorsports Park for $2,200,000 - Still Available!

CLICK HERE FOR FULL AD!

Start your new Motorsports enterprise with Today's Cool Classified Find! Located just outside of Albuquerque New Mexico. Details from the seller:

Sandia Motorsports Park is an 87 acre facility located just minutes from 1 million customers in the Albuquerque metropolitan area. Sandia has a 1.7 mile paved road course, a large 3/8 mile paved banked oval and a 1/4 mile paved oval plus a 3/8 mile banked dirt tract and a 1/4 mile dirt tract, and a 1/4 midget track. All racing venues have bleachers with the main asphalt track having bathrooms, cooking and meeting facilities. This is an ongoing operation for over 16 years. Lease or lease to purchase considered.
